James Browning Wyeth (born July 6, 1946) is a contemporary American realist painter, son of Andrew Wyeth, and grandson of N.C. Wyeth. He was raised in Chadds Ford Township, Pennsylvania, and is artistic receiver to the Brandywine School tradition – painters who worked in the rural Brandywine River Place of Delaware and Pennsylvania, portraying its people, animals, and landscape.
